Role Summary

The Director of Quality is responsible for the effective management of Yogi’s Quality Programs. This role encompasses hands-on responsibilities in governing the elements of product quality assurance and control; dietary supplements compliance (21CFR Part 111); and food regulations compliance (21CFR Part 110 and 117).  This position will provide leadership for the development, implementation, communication, and maintenance of Quality Management Systems, policies and procedures in accordance with US FDA regulations, Global Food Safety Initiatives, and industry best practices.

WHAT YOU’LL OWN:                                             

Regulatory Compliance                                

•    Leads the Company in meetings with the US FDA, Oregon Department of Agriculture, other regulatory agencies and third-party inspections and audits.

•    Responsible for the effective management and maintenance of manufacturing facility compliance to and with the dietary supplement’s regulations 21CFR Part 111, 110, and 117.

•    Responsible for the effective management and maintenance of Quality Audit program and assessing improvement initiatives resulting from all quality audits, internal and external; the Company’s sanitation program ensuring compliance to FDA and cGMP practices; the documentation and retention processes as it relates to the Quality System and FDA guidelines/regulations; and development and validation of laboratory test methods

Continuous Improvement                                     

•    Effectively interact with Manufacturing, Sourcing, and R&D to maintain product supply and transition new products from the bench, through piloting and into production

•    Analyze, evaluate, trend, and present key performance quality indicators and recommendations to executive management on a quarterly and annual basis

•    Maintain and continuously improve the company’s quality management system by directing and providing oversight and input into the relevant quality systems and standards; provide oversight to the EWTC CAPA team

•    Collaborate with Production to ensure quality inspections, product release programs for incoming, in-process, and finished goods meet specifications

•    Provide oversight for Supplier qualification procedures, audit plans, and assessments

•    Ensure equipment, material qualification and validation procedures are available and followed, including review and approval of risk assessments, quality testing plans, qualification/validation protocols, specification management, and release of test product

Leadership and Team Development                                 

•    Hire, manage, and develop Quality staff to support the company’s goals and objectives; conduct performance evaluations; assist in setting goals and objectives in alignment with the overall company goals and objectives

•    Develop and gain alignment on the annual Quality budget including allocations for capital expenses; ensure adherence throughout the fiscal year 

•    Direct, participate in, and provide philosophical direction on the “culture of Quality” for the Company

•    Maintenance of the Quality Management Systems

•    Training of all company personnel in regulatory and GFSI requirements

•    Provide leadership on Food Safety, Food Defense and HACCP teams

WHAT WE DO:

We manufacture Yogi and Choice Organics brand products. Yogi has over 40 tea blends made from 140 exotic spices and botanicals sourced from 100% non-GMO growers around the globe. These herbal, green, and black teas are formulated for delicious taste and healthful benefits. Choice Organics offers a collection of organic traditional tea, herbal tea, and unique, flavorful organic tea blends. Choice teas are sourced exclusively from 100% organic and non-GMO growers around the world and are beautifully balanced to perfection for a full-flavored taste experience.
